NOAA Fisheries announces approval of New England Marine Monitoring, Inc. to provide observer services to Atlantic sea scallop vessels. For more information on the industry-funded sea scallop observer program, all available observer providers, and guidance on getting observers, visit us here.

Reminder: Beginning April 1, 2024, scallop vessel owners and operators will be required to notify NOAA Fisheries of their intent to fish using the Pre-Trip Notification System (PTNS). Please visit the Scallop PTNS webpage for more details.
